Inscríbete en LibraryThing para averiguar si este libro te gustará. Actualmente no hay Conversaciones sobre este libro. This is the book I usually go to to identify birds I see on my property. I have a number of bird watching books, but none of them compares to this excellent and handy field guide. The headings and divisions make sense, the illustrations are both beautiful and detailed, while the individual descriptions of the birds are informative without being longwinded. Furthermore, the book not only lists a number of extinct North American bird species, but also indicates which North American bird species are currently threatened and/or endangered, often along with some of the reasons why this might be the case. It would be wonderful if the same author would consider compiling a similar book listing the birds of Europe (a book on the birds of Hawaii, many of which are severely threatened, would be a wonderful idea as well). Highly, highly recommended!! ( ) A decent field guide, and possibly a good bet for someone just starting out. The birds are organized differently than in most of the field guides available. IIRC, they're listed by habitat, rather than taxonomic order. Personally, I found this confusing rather than helpful, so I gave the book away. The illustrations are nice, though, but I think there are better guides available. (Sibley is my current fave). sin reseñas | añadir una reseña
A surer, faster, easier way to identify birds Everything you need to know about North American birds is at your fingertips in this ground-breaking field guide--the first and only guide to successfully organize birds by field-recognizable, instantly-observable characteristics. With its unique keying system based on how and where birds collect food, spectacular panoramic color illustrations, weather-resistant pocket-size format, emphasis on conservation, and endorsement by the leading bird preservation organization, All the Birds is the single most useful identification guide available. How to use All the Birds of North America Step #1: Open to the key for Waterbirds on the inside front cover or to the key for Landbirds on the inside back cover. Step #2: Select the icon that most resembles the bird being identified, and note the color bar and key number next to that icon. Using the color bar and key number, locate the group of birds within the pages of the book. No se han encontrado descripciones de biblioteca. |
